Neuware - 'A Struggle for Rome' transports readers to the tumultuous 5th century AD, a period of dramatic upheaval and conflict as the Roman Empire teeters on the brink of collapse. Julius Sophus Felix Dahn masterfully weaves a tale of courage, betrayal, and the clash of civilizations during the Gothic… Wars. As Visigoths and Romans collide, individual destinies become intertwined with the fate of an empire. This compelling narrative brings to life the epic scale of the struggle for Rome, offering a vivid portrayal of a pivotal moment in history. Experience the drama and intrigue as characters grapple with love, loyalty, and survival amidst the chaos of war.
